Born in Orlando, Florida, Sereno is an American director, producer, writer, and actor. Currently he is a senior at the University of North Carolina at Wilmington studying film production. He has studied rigorously under nationally recognized film production and film studies professors: Terry Linehan, Dr. Todd Berliner, Georg Koszulinski, Dr. Tim Palmer, Thomas Kohlbrenner, and Dr. Masha Shpolberg. Despite his age, he has already built-up a wide array of film works. In 2015, he created his own digital-release television show known as The Sereno Show which still runs today. Additionally, he has directed and produced over 120 short films, along with assuming other roles in some of these productions as well (editor, actor, etc). He has also directed and produced two feature films as of 2022: Limbo (2019) and Black & White (2020).
